Who Is Abdul Kadir Karding Who Prabowo Trusts To Be The Minister Who Takes Care Of Indonesian Migrant Workers?

JAKARTA - Organization and the world of politics are not foreign to Abdul Kadir Karding. At a fairly young age, 26 years old, Karding has sat on the regional legislature seat and is trusted to serve as Chairman of Commission E of the Central Java DPRD.

In addition to regional legislature, Karding has also penetrated the center and has sat in several House of Representatives Commissions for assignments.

Starting from Commission III of the DPR RI in charge of law, human rights and security, Commission VIII regarding religion and social affairs, and Commission X in the fields of education, sports, and history.

During the administration of President Prabowo Subianto and his deputy Gibran Rakabuming Raka, Kadir Karding was trusted as one of the ministers in managing the placement of Indonesian migrant workers.

This is a new ministry previously the Indonesian Migrant Worker Protection Agency (BP2MI) with the status of a non-ministerial government agency.

The focus of this ministry is to strengthen protection for Indonesian migrant workers who are abroad.

Born in Donggala, Central Sulawesi, March 25, 1973, Abdul Kadir Karding entered formal education at SDN Ogoamas I elementary school, Sojol, Donggala, Central Sulawesi.

DNA politics began to be seen when he became involved as Chair of the Student Senate of the Faculty of Animal Husbandry UNDIP Semarang in 1994-1995, Deputy Secretary of PC PMII Semarang

Chairman I of the Central Java PMII Koorcab to the Central Java Independent Election Monitoring Committee (KIPP).

From the campus Senate and PMII, Karding stepped into a political party in 1998-2001 as Secretary of the Central Java PKB DPW and continued to 'up' until he served as Secretary General of PKB in 2016-2019.

With a row of experiences, achievements and positive track records, in 2019, Karding was trusted to be Deputy Chairperson of TKN Joko Widodo-Ma'ruf Amin.

Achievements As Members Of The DPR

1. Chairman of Commission VIII DPR RI conducts Rapid Rehabilitation and Reconstruction Guards after the eruption of Mount Merapi in Central Java and DI Yogyakarta and Mount Sinabung in Karo Regency, North Sumatra Province.

2. Chairman of Commission VIII DPR RI conducts escorts, handling floods and landslides in various regions.

3. As Chairman of Commission VIII of the DPR RI, escort the discussion and ratification of Law Number 13 of 2011 concerning Handling the Poor.

4. As Chairman of Commission VIII of the DPR RI, escort the Bill on Ratification of the Rights of Persons with Disabilities.

5. As Chairman of Commission VIII DPR RI succeeded in reducing the Cost of Organizing Hajj (BPIH) in 2010 and 2011.

6. As Chairman of Commission VIII, the DPR RI is able to mediate the problem of the SARA conflict in the form of attacks on Ahmadiyah adherents in West Java, burning churches in Temanggung Regency, problems with street children and various other social problems.
